Observation under Natural  Setting Laboratory Setting:

Observation under Natural Setting Laboratory Setting: Observations in field studies are in their natural setting and are studied in extremely realistic conditions. Sometimes an experimental manipulation maybe introduced in afield study. Observation in a laboratory setting on the other hand enables the observer to control extraneous variables. Which influence the behaviour of people observational studies in laboratory setting have certain advantages over field studies. They enable the collection of data promptly and economically and in addition. Permit the use of more objective measurements.
